Urban vs. Suburban Markets
One of the biggest regional differences in luxury home prices is between urban and suburban areas.
-
Urban Areas:
Major cities often have higher luxury home prices due to limited space, strong infrastructure, and high demand. Premium locations, skyline views, and proximity to business hubs drive prices upward. -
Suburban Areas:
Suburbs are gaining popularity as buyers look for larger homes and peaceful environments. While prices may be lower than in cities, demand is rising, which is gradually increasing property values.
Coastal vs. Inland Regions
Geography plays a key role in shaping luxury home prices.
-
Coastal Regions:
Properties near beaches or waterfronts are usually more expensive. Scenic views, tourism, and lifestyle appeal make these areas highly desirable. -
Inland Regions:
Inland luxury homes can be more affordable while still offering premium features like large plots and privacy. These regions often attract buyers looking for value without compromising comfort.

Risk Factors to Consider
Like any investment, luxury real estate comes with risks. Understanding these factors is essential before making a decision.
-
Market Volatility: Luxury home prices can be sensitive to economic changes.
-
High Maintenance Costs: Upkeep and management can be expensive.
-
Liquidity Issues: Selling a luxury property may take longer compared to standard homes.
